引言
在数字化通讯日益普及的今天,安全性已经成为了人们关注的重要议题。TokenIM作为一种新兴的通讯工具,因其专注于安全认证而备受青睐。然而,用户在使用TokenIM时,可能会遇到签名失败的问题,这不仅会造成用户体验的降低,也可能影响到数据传输的安全性。本文将深入探讨TokenIM签名失败的原因,并为用户提供有效的解决方案。同时,将讨论在使用TokenIM时常见的相关问题,帮助用户更好地理解和使用该平台。
TokenIM签名失败的原因分析
TokenIM 使用基于加密的安全通信,签名过程是确保数据完整性和真实性的关键。然而,用户在使用过程中的一些常见原因可能导致签名失败:
- 私钥丢失或错误: TokenIM使用的私钥是进行签名的基础。如果用户丢失或错误输入私钥,将无法生成有效签名,进而导致签名失败。
- 签名算法不匹配: TokenIM可能支持多种签名算法,如RSA、ECDSA等。如果在生成签名时所使用的算法与接收方预期的不一致,就会导致签名无法验证。
- 数据被篡改: 由于网络传输过程中的问题,数据可能被意外或恶意地篡改,这时原有的签名将无法匹配新的数据,导致验证失败。
- TokenIM软件版本 有时候,TokenIM版本更新可能会引入新的功能或修复某些bug。如果使用的版本存在问题,也可能影响到签名过程。
解决TokenIM签名失败的问题
针对上述可能导致签名失败的原因,以下是一些推荐的解决方案:
- 备份和验证私钥: 确保私钥的安全存储,同时定期备份并验证其完整性。如果怀疑私钥可能被泄露,重新生成私钥是必要的步骤。
- 检查签名算法: 在生成签名和验证签名时,确保使用同一算法。用户可以在TokenIM的文档中查阅当前支持的算法列表,并确保一致。
- 确保数据完整性: 可以使用校验和或哈希函数来验证数据在传输过程中的完整性。如果发现数据变化,应重新签名。
- 保持软件更新: 定期查看TokenIM的更新日志,及时进行软件更新,确保使用最新版的功能和安全补丁。
相关问题探讨
在使用TokenIM的过程中,用户可能会面临以下五个常见问题。我们将逐一深入讨论这些问题及其解决方案。
如何处理TokenIM中的私钥丢失问题?
私钥对TokenIM的用户至关重要,因此,丢失私钥将导致无法访问相关的加密内容。以下是几种处理私钥丢失问题的建议:
- 私钥的备份: 用户在初始化TokenIM时应当立即备份私钥。可以选择将私钥保存在多个安全的位置,例如USB驱动器、密码管理器或安全的云存储服务中。
- 私钥恢复计划: 制定私钥恢复计划,一旦丢失,能够快速重新生成。TokenIM通常提供重新生成密钥的选项,但请务必记录新的私钥。
- 多重签名方式: 考虑实施多重签名策略,即多个私钥共同控制同一账户。这样,即使一个私钥丢失,仍可以通过其他私钥来恢复控制。
总之,私钥的管理和备份在使用TokenIM时是十分必要的,用户必须重视并制定相应的策略,以确保数据传输的安全性与可靠性。
TokenIM的签名算法有什么选择,如何选择合适的算法?
TokenIM支持多种签名算法,用户如何选择合适的算法将直接影响到其安全性及性能。以下是一些常用的签名算法及其优缺点:
- RSA: RSA是一种传统的公钥加密算法,具有较强的安全性。优点在于其广泛的应用和兼容性,但它的性能在处理大数据时较低,签名速度较慢。
- ECDSA: 椭圆曲线数字签名算法相较于RSA具有更高的安全性和更快的处理速度。它适合资源受限的设备,但由于其复杂性,相比之下学习曲线较陡峭。
- SHA-256等哈希算法: 通常与上述公钥算法结合使用,用于数据完整性校验。选用合适的哈希算法可以有效增加数据传输的安全性。
在选择签名算法时,用户应当综合考虑安全性、性能以及兼容性等多方面因素,选择一种最符合自己需求的算法。
如何确保TokenIM传输过程中数据完整性?
数据在传输过程中的完整性要求极为严格,TokenIM提供了几种方式来保证数据在传输过程中的完整性:
- 数据哈希: 使用哈希算法对发送的数据进行校验。在数据发送时计算其哈希值,并在接收端对比,只有一致才能确认数据未被篡改。
- 加密通道: 利用TokenIM提供的加密通道进行数据传输,确保数据在网络中的安全。这可以有效防止中间人攻击和数据篡改。
- 监控与日志: 开启TokenIM的监控和日志功能,及时记录数据传输中发生的异常情况。通过分析日志,用户可以及时发现并处理潜在的问题。
通过上述方法,用户可以在使用TokenIM时,提高数据传输的安全性,确保信息不被 unauthorized access 和篡改。
TokenIM的版本更新有哪些注意事项?
在数字工具不断发展的今天,软件更新是不可避免的。使用TokenIM的用户须规避版本更新可能引发的问题,以下是应注意的事项:
- 查看更新日志: 每次更新前,用户应仔细阅读更新日志,了解此次更新所包含的功能、修复及已知问题,评估是否需要及时更新。
- 备份旧版本: 在进行版本更新之前,可以将当前版本进行备份,以防新版本出现安全或兼容性问题时能够轻松恢复。
- 参与社区反馈: 加入TokenIM用户社区,与其他用户分享使用经验及遇到的问题,可能会帮助您更好地理解产品的变化。
遵循以上建议,用户可以确保在升级TokenIM版本的过程中降低潜在风险,提升使用体验。
使用TokenIM提升通讯安全性的最佳实践有哪些?
为了提升TokenIM的通讯安全性,用户可以遵循以下最佳实践:
- 定期更换密码: 对TokenIM账户密码定期进行更换,并使用数字、字母及特殊字符组合的复杂密码。
- 开启二次认证: 使用双因素认证提高账户安全性,即使密码泄露,攻击者仍需第二个认证因素才能登录。
- 安全意识培训: 对团队成员进行安全意识培训,提高他们对网络安全的认识,防止社交工程攻击等方式获取账户信息。
- 审查权限设置: 定期审查TokenIM中各个用户的权限设置,确保每个用户只拥有所需的最小权限,降低风险。
- 实时监控异常行为: 利用TokenIM提供的实时监控功能,检查异常活动并及时采取措施。
通过执行这些最佳实践,用户不仅可以提升与TokenIM的通讯安全性,还可以增强整个组织的信息安全能力。
总结
在使用TokenIM进行安全通信的过程中,用户们可能会遇到包括签名失败在内的各种问题。通过了解造成签名失败的原因,并采取有效的措施来解决这些问题,用户可以确保通讯的安全性和稳定性。同时,本文也探讨了其他相关问题,旨在帮助用户更好地把握TokenIM这款工具,为用户提供更为安全与高效的数字通讯体验。
tpwallet
T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。